REFIT: French & Webb Paine 45 Weekender

Vessel: French & Webb Paine 45 Weekender

Name: Margaret
Owners: David & Margaret C
Hailing Port: Walpole, Maine

When David and Margaret C acquired their Paine 45 Weekender, built and launched by French & Webb in 2006, the boat was in good shape, but they had  a long list of modifications that would further customize and beautify the boat to support their sailing goals and personal aesthetic. They asked the GIBY team to manage the refit.

Work Scope:

  • Repair dings in cold molded epoxy wood hull
  • Paint gutters around teak deck & house
  • Clear-coat finish hull & house with Awlgrip
  • Modify mast & gooseneck to accommodate in-boom furling main sail
  • Install Offshore Spars furling boom
  • Bend on new Doyle main sail & genoa
  • Replace mainsheet traveler lines
  • Re-bed genoa turning blocks
  • Remove and re-bed hatches
  • Install new water tanks under forward berth
  • Inspect steering system
  • Mount new B&G instruments, run cable & interface
  • Service sail drive
  • Design & fabricate new dinghy hoist system
  • Extend toe rails aft
  • Fabricate cabinetry for additional stowage in galley
  • Fabricate mahogany cup holders, install in cockpit
  • Fabricate anchor roller extension & fairlead
  • Fabricate & install anchor scuff plates
  • Remove bow pulpit
  • Redesign lifelines at bow, plunge to a sporty angle
  • Fabricate & install stainless steel deck plate to support new life line design
  • Fabricate & install new deck-mounted LED navigation lights
  • Wire navigation lights
  • Modify anchor rode chute
  • Test sail
